1984 GMC Jimmy vs. 2005 Mitsubishi Colt

To start off, 2005 Mitsubishi Colt is newer by 21 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 GMC Jimmy.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 GMC Jimmy would be higher. At 1,991 cc (4 cylinders), 1984 GMC Jimmy is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Mitsubishi Colt (94 HP) has 13 more horse power than 1984 GMC Jimmy. (81 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Mitsubishi Colt should accelerate faster than 1984 GMC Jimmy.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1984 GMC Jimmy weights approximately 325 kg more than 2005 Mitsubishi Colt.

Because 1984 GMC Jimmy is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 Mitsubishi Colt.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1984 GMC Jimmy will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Mitsubishi Colt (213 Nm @ 1800 RPM) has 67 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 GMC Jimmy. (146 Nm @ 2400 RPM). This means 2005 Mitsubishi Colt will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 GMC Jimmy. 2005 Mitsubishi Colt has automatic transmission and 1984 GMC Jimmy has manual transmission. 1984 GMC Jimmy will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2005 Mitsubishi Colt will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
